P methyl bha mbha resin
P-methyl-BHA (MBHA) resin is a solid-phase synthesis resin used in organic chemistry. It is designed for the preparation of peptides and other organic compounds. The resin consists of a polystyrene-divinylbenzene copolymer matrix with pendant 4-methylbenzhydrylamine (MBHA) groups, which serve as the functional groups for chemical reactions.
